Live the College Life at Capital

Education is the core idea when it comes to college, but you’re not going to be in class 24/7. At Capital, there’s a lot more to life than pop quizzes and PowerPoint presentations.

On-Campus Living

You’ll find a relaxed, friendly atmosphere in all six of Capital’s residence halls (including the new, suite-style College Avenue hall). Hang out with friends. Play foosball in the lounge. Or check out student activities such as comedians, bands and CapFest.

Stay Active

Stay active with 18 NCAA Division III varsity sports, 12 intramural sports and the fitness possibilities in the 126,000-square-foot Capital Center.
